Mapping vegetation cover is a significant application of remote sensing in environmental science. Remote sensing involves acquiring data about the Earth's surface through satellite or aerial imagery, which allows scientists to observe and analyze large areas quickly and efficiently. By utilizing various spectral bands of light, remote sensing technology can identify different types of vegetation, assess plant health, and monitor changes in vegetation over time, such as deforestation or habitat restoration efforts. This data is crucial for understanding ecosystem dynamics, managing natural resources, and making informed decisions in environmental conservation.
